Rocky Linux 9.3 安装 SonarQube 10.3 (超级详细版本)

2023-12-21 13:28:14

安装步骤

SonarQube官网安装文档

更新yum

sudo yum upgrade

安装JDK17

sudo yum -y install fontconfig java-17-openjdk-devel

安装unzip和wget

sudo yum -y install unzip
sudo yum -y install wget

创建新用户和密码(因为SonarQube要使用非root用户启动)

adduser sonarqube
passwd sonarqube
usermod -a -G wheel sonarqube

下载资源包(此时使用非root用户操作,用sonarqube用户操作)

mkdir -p /usr/local/sonarqube && cd /usr/local/sonarqube
wget https://binaries.sonarsource.com/Distribution/sonarqube/sonarqube-10.3.0.82913.zip

解压文件

unzip sonarqube-10.3.0.82913.zip

赋予sonarqube用户权限

chown -R sonarqube:sonarqube /usr/local/sonarqube/
chmod -R 775 /usr/local/sonarqube/

安装中文版拓展插件(不需要可以跳过此步骤)

插件地址:SonarQube中文插件包

(GitHub访问慢可以私信我,帮你解决,保证有效)

把jar包放在下面的路径下即可

/usr/loca/sonarqube/sonarqube-10.3.0.82913/extensions/plugins/

启动SonarQube(使用非root用户)

看日志启动

sh /usr/local/sonarqube/sonarqube-10.3.0.82913/bin/linux-x86-64/sonar.sh console

后台启动

sh /usr/local/sonarqube/sonarqube-10.3.0.82913/bin/linux-x86-64/sonar.sh start

停止

sh /usr/local/sonarqube/sonarqube-10.3.0.82913/bin/linux-x86-64/sonar.sh stop

访问SonarQube

地址:http://IP:9000/? ?

(如果访问不了,就是防火墙的问题,可以关闭防火墙或者开通9000端口)

账号:admin

密码:admin

进入系统需要改密码

?

文章来源:https://blog.csdn.net/qq_34417433/article/details/135118571
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。